November 9, 1989, marked the Fall of the Berlin Wall. One year later, thanks to Winston Churchill's granddaughter, Edwina Sandys. 8 sections of the Berlin Wall were placed at America's National Churchill Museum on the campus of Westminster College. Former President Ronald Reagan dedicated the sculpture called "Breakthrough." The man- and woman-shaped sections cut out of the wall by Sandys represent breaking through from East Berlin to the freedom of West Berlin.
